/// Reactive override for the syntax-highlighting theme used by rendered code blocks.
///
/// Provide this context above [`MdxContent`](crate::MdxContent) (or any component that
/// renders [`DocCodeBlock`]) to control the code theme — for example to track a
/// site-wide light/dark toggle driven by the `data-theme` attribute.
///
/// When no override is provided, code blocks fall back to
/// `CodeTheme::system(Theme::GITHUB_LIGHT, Theme::TOKYO_NIGHT)`, which switches on the
/// reader's OS `prefers-color-scheme`.
///
/// Only available with the `highlight` feature (default), which pulls in `dioxus-code`.
#[cfg(feature = "highlight")]
#[derive(Clone, Copy)]
pub struct CodeThemeOverride(pub ReadSignal<CodeTheme>);

/// Fallback for [`HighlightedCode`] when the `highlight` feature is disabled.
///
/// Renders the code as an escaped plain-text node inside the same
/// `<pre class="dxc"><code>` markup the highlighted path emits, so the outer
/// wrappers, copy buttons, and CodeGroup tabs keep working — only token coloring
/// is lost. See [`plain_code_block`] for why the base layout is inlined.
#[cfg(not(feature = "highlight"))]
#[component]
fn HighlightedCode(props: HighlightedCodeProps) -> Element {
    plain_code_block(&props.code)
}

/// Render a `<pre class="dxc"><code>` block containing the code as an escaped
/// plain-text node, used when syntax highlighting is disabled.
///
/// Without the `highlight` feature `dioxus-code`'s stylesheet is not linked, so its
/// base `.dxc` layout (padding, `overflow: auto`, monospace font) is inlined here to
/// keep scrolling and spacing intact.
#[cfg(not(feature = "highlight"))]
pub(crate) fn plain_code_block(code: &str) -> Element {
    rsx! {
        pre {
            class: "dxc",
            margin: "0",
            padding: "1rem",
            overflow: "auto",
            tab_size: "4",
            font_family: "ui-monospace, SFMono-Regular, Menlo, Monaco, Consolas, \"Liberation Mono\", monospace",
            font_size: "0.9rem",
            line_height: "1.55",
            code { "{code}" }
        }
    }
}

#[cfg(feature = "highlight")]
pub(crate) fn code_language(language: Option<&str>, filename: Option<&str>) -> Language {
    language
        .and_then(language_from_alias)
        .or_else(|| filename.and_then(Language::detect))
        .or_else(|| language.and_then(Language::detect))
        .unwrap_or(Language::Markdown)
}
